Overview

The MOJO2 are bone conduction headphones designed by MOJAWA, offering a unique audio experience with an open-ear design.

Function Description

The MOJO2 headphones are primarily designed for audio playback and communication. They feature a noise-cancelling microphone for clear calls and a magnetic charging port for convenient power replenishment. The device is controlled via a combination of a power/multi-function button and a volume control touchpad.

Power On/Off: To power on, press and hold the power button for 2 seconds until you hear "power on" and the indicator light turns on. To power off, press and hold the power button for 2 seconds until you hear "power off" and the indicator light turns off.

Volume Control: The right side of the headset features a volume control touchpad. Sliding your finger upward increases the volume, while sliding it downward decreases it. The sliding speed can be adjusted for larger volume changes.

Multi-function Button & Volume Control Touchpad:

  • Play/Pause Music: Press the multi-function button once.
  • Skip to Next Track: Press the multi-function button twice.
  • Back to Previous Track: Press the multi-function button three times.
  • Answer a Call: Press the multi-function button once when an incoming call rings.
  • Decline a Call: Press the multi-function button twice when an incoming call rings.
  • Cancel an Outgoing Call: Press the multi-function button once while calling.
  • Hang Up a Call: Press the multi-function button once during a call.
  • Hold A's Call and Answer Incoming Call from B: During a call with A, press the multi-function button once to answer incoming call from B.
  • End Call with A and Answer Incoming Call from B: During a call with A, press the multi-function button twice to end call with A and answer incoming call from B.
  • Voice Assistant: Click the touchpad twice.

Bluetooth Connectivity: The MOJO2 supports Bluetooth 5.2 for wireless connection to devices.

  • Pairing: When the headset is powered off, press and hold the power button for 5 seconds. You will hear "power on" followed by a pairing tone, and the indicator light will flash, indicating pairing mode. In your device's Bluetooth settings, search for "MOJO2" and tap to connect. A successful pairing will be indicated by a sound, and the indicator light will turn off.
  • Unpair: From your device's Bluetooth settings, select "MOJO2" and choose "unpair." An indicator sound will confirm successful unpairing. After unpairing, the indicator light will flash, indicating readiness for pairing with another device.
  • Connect: When powered on, the headset automatically connects to the last connected device. Manual connection to another device is possible via Bluetooth settings. The indicator light turns off upon successful connection; if connection fails, it will continue flashing.
  • Disconnect: In your device's Bluetooth settings, select "MOJO2" and choose "disconnect." An indicator sound will confirm successful disconnection.
  • Reconnect Automatically: If the headset disconnects due to exceeding the Bluetooth range, it enters pairing mode with a flashing indicator light. If it returns within range within 10 minutes, it will automatically reconnect. Otherwise, it will shut down after 10 minutes.

LED Light Indicators:

  • Indicator light on: Power on.
  • Indicator light off: Power off.
  • Indicator light flashing slowly: Not connected.
  • Indicator light flashing quickly: Pairing.
  • Indicator light stops flashing and turns off: Connected.
  • Indicator light flashing slowly (while charging): Charging, battery at medium capacity.
  • Indicator light flashing quickly (while charging): Charging, low battery, quick-charging.
  • Indicator light on for 3 minutes then turns off: Battery fully charged.
  • Battery Low (white light flashes 3 times quickly): Low battery.
  • Very low battery (white light flashes slowly 3 times): Very low battery.

Important Technical Specifications

  • Model: MOJO2
  • Speaker: Bone Conduction Speaker
  • Frequency Response: 2.4GHz
  • Bluetooth Version: BT5.2
  • Bluetooth Range: 10m
  • Bluetooth Protocol: A2DP1.3, HFP, AVRCP 1.5
  • Battery Type: Lithium Ion Battery
  • Battery Capacity: 130mAh
  • Charging Input: 5V ⎓ 500mA
  • Charging Time: <=80min
  • Playtime: 8 hours
  • Standby Time: 130 hours
  • Microphone Sensitivity: -38dB
  • Waterproof Rating: IP67
  • Weight: 26g
  • Warranty: 1 Year

Usage Features

Wearing the Headset: Identify the left and right sides by the volume control touchpad and LED indicator, which should be on the right side. Wrap the headset around your head and let it rest on your ears.

Restore to Factory Settings: To restore the headset to factory settings, power it on, then press and hold the power button for 8 seconds. All pairing information will be deleted, and the headset will automatically restart in pairing mode. It is recommended to charge the headset before first use and ensure the charging port is dry.

Earplugs: For a more focused listening experience in noisy environments, the included earplugs can be used to block out background noises. Roll the earplugs to fit into your ears.

Maintenance Features

Storage and Maintenance:

  • Storage Conditions: Store the headset in a cool and dry place.
  • Operating Temperature: Use at ambient temperatures between 0°C (32°F) and 55°C (131°F).
  • Charging Temperature: Charge at ambient temperatures between 0°C and 40°C.
  • Battery Life: Extremely cold, hot, or humid environments may shorten battery life.
  • Recharge Frequency: If left unused for a long time, recharge the headset before use.
  • Cleaning: The headset can be cleaned regularly. Avoid using high-pressure water to wash the microphone or immersing the product in water for extended periods, as this may damage the microphone or waterproof performance. If the charging port is wet, dry it with a soft dry cloth before charging.

Safety Instructions:

  • Children and Pets: Keep the headset away from children and pets when not in use. The product contains lithium batteries which can be dangerous if swallowed; seek immediate medical attention if swallowed.
  • Hearing Protection: Avoid using the headset at high volume for extended periods. Use at a moderate volume to prevent hearing damage and sound distortion. Turn down the volume before placing the headset on your ears, then gradually increase to a comfortable listening level.
  • Driving Safety: Use with caution while driving and adhere to applicable laws regarding mobile phones and headsets. Some jurisdictions have specific limitations. Do not use the headset for other purposes while driving.
  • Concentration Activities: During activities requiring concentration (cycling, walking near roads, construction sites, railways), pay attention to your safety and others. Follow relevant laws.
  • Choking Hazard: Contains small parts, not suitable for children under age 3.
  • Magnetic Material: Contains magnetic material. Consult a physician if you have an implanted medical device.
  • Modifications: Do not make unauthorized alterations to the product.
  • Power Sources: Use only with power sources approved by relevant authorities and meeting local regulatory requirements (e.g., UL, CSA, VDE, CCC).
  • Heat Exposure: Do not expose the product to excessive heat (avoid direct sunlight and fire). High temperatures, smoke, or fumes can cause the product to catch fire.
  • Charging Precautions: Do not charge the headset during thunder and lightning.
  • Disposal: Do not throw the headset into fire, as the battery may explode under high temperatures.
